tree/branch: https://git.kernel.org/pub/scm/linux/kernel/git/dtor/input.git gpio-of-cleanups branch HEAD: 2720bc0c1c4c13a5f20c55d5d6a077522b46a430 soc: fsl: qe: switch to using gpiod API Error/Warning reports: https://lore.kernel.org/linux-input/202209251708.6nw3olDU-lkp@xxxxxxxxx Error/Warning: (recently discovered and may have been fixed) drivers/soc/fsl/qe/gpio.c:183:12: warning: assignment to 'struct gpio_chip *' from 'int' makes pointer from integer without a cast [-Wint-conversion] drivers/soc/fsl/qe/gpio.c:183:14: error: implicit declaration of function 'gpio_to_chip'; did you mean 'gpiod_to_chip'? [-Werror=implicit-function-declaration] drivers/soc/fsl/qe/gpio.c:23:32: error: field 'mm_gc' has incomplete type drivers/soc/fsl/qe/gpio.c:341:23: error: implicit declaration of function 'of_mm_gpiochip_add_data'; did you mean 'devm_gpiochip_add_data'? [-Werror=implicit-function-declaration] drivers/soc/fsl/qe/gpio.c:40:49: error: invalid use of undefined type 'struct of_mm_gpio_chip' drivers/soc/fsl/qe/gpio.c:53:41: error: implicit declaration of function 'to_of_mm_gpio_chip' [-Werror=implicit-function-declaration] drivers/soc/fsl/qe/gpio.c:53:41: warning: initialization of 'struct of_mm_gpio_chip *' from 'int' makes pointer from integer without a cast [-Wint-conversion] Error/Warning ids grouped by kconfigs: gcc_recent_errors |-- powerpc-allmodconfig | |-- drivers-soc-fsl-qe-gpio.c:error:field-mm_gc-has-incomplete-type | |-- drivers-soc-fsl-qe-gpio.c:error:implicit-declaration-of-function-gpio_to_chip | |-- drivers-soc-fsl-qe-gpio.c:error:implicit-declaration-of-function-of_mm_gpiochip_add_data | |-- drivers-soc-fsl-qe-gpio.c:error:implicit-declaration-of-function-to_of_mm_gpio_chip | |-- drivers-soc-fsl-qe-gpio.c:error:invalid-use-of-undefined-type-struct-of_mm_gpio_chip | |-- drivers-soc-fsl-qe-gpio.c:warning:assignment-to-struct-gpio_chip-from-int-makes-pointer-from-integer-without-a-cast | `-- drivers-soc-fsl-qe-gpio.c:warning:initialization-of-struct-of_mm_gpio_chip-from-int-makes-pointer-from-integer-without-a-cast `-- powerpc-allyesconfig |-- drivers-soc-fsl-qe-gpio.c:error:field-mm_gc-has-incomplete-type |-- drivers-soc-fsl-qe-gpio.c:error:implicit-declaration-of-function-gpio_to_chip |-- drivers-soc-fsl-qe-gpio.c:error:implicit-declaration-of-function-of_mm_gpiochip_add_data |-- drivers-soc-fsl-qe-gpio.c:error:implicit-declaration-of-function-to_of_mm_gpio_chip |-- drivers-soc-fsl-qe-gpio.c:error:invalid-use-of-undefined-type-struct-of_mm_gpio_chip |-- drivers-soc-fsl-qe-gpio.c:warning:assignment-to-struct-gpio_chip-from-int-makes-pointer-from-integer-without-a-cast `-- drivers-soc-fsl-qe-gpio.c:warning:initialization-of-struct-of_mm_gpio_chip-from-int-makes-pointer-from-integer-without-a-cast elapsed time: 721m configs tested: 58 configs skipped: 2 gcc tested configs: arc defconfig x86_64 defconfig alpha defconfig x86_64 randconfig-a002 i386 defconfig x86_64 rhel-8.3 x86_64 randconfig-a004 x86_64 randconfig-a006 um i386_defconfig um x86_64_defconfig arm defconfig i386 randconfig-a001 i386 randconfig-a003 x86_64 allyesconfig s390 defconfig i386 randconfig-a005 x86_64 randconfig-a015 i386 allyesconfig arm64 allyesconfig powerpc allnoconfig arm allyesconfig x86_64 randconfig-a013 s390 allmodconfig powerpc allmodconfig x86_64 randconfig-a011 x86_64 rhel-8.3-func mips allyesconfig alpha allyesconfig sh allmodconfig x86_64 rhel-8.3-kselftests s390 allyesconfig x86_64 rhel-8.3-kvm i386 randconfig-a014 i386 randconfig-a012 arc randconfig-r043-20220925 arc allyesconfig i386 randconfig-a016 x86_64 rhel-8.3-kunit m68k allyesconfig x86_64 rhel-8.3-syz m68k allmodconfig s390 randconfig-r044-20220925 riscv randconfig-r042-20220925 ia64 allmodconfig clang tested configs: x86_64 randconfig-a001 x86_64 randconfig-a003 x86_64 randconfig-a005 i386 randconfig-a002 i386 randconfig-a004 x86_64 randconfig-a014 i386 randconfig-a006 x86_64 randconfig-a016 x86_64 randconfig-a012 i386 randconfig-a013 i386 randconfig-a015 i386 randconfig-a011 hexagon randconfig-r041-20220925 hexagon randconfig-r045-20220925 -- 0-DAY CI Kernel Test Service https://01.org/lkp